Here are some passport rules and travel advisories for Canadian travelers:
Validity: Passports must be valid for the duration of your stay in the destination country.
Dual Citizenship: Canadian citizens with dual citizenship must present a valid Canadian passport to board a flight to Canada.
Entry and Exit Requirements: Check the entry and exit requirements of your destination country.
Travel Documents: Keep digital or physical copies of your travel documents in a safe place.
Travel Advisories: Check travel advisories and advisories for your destination country. Some countries are issuing travel advisories advising against all travel or to exercise extreme caution.
Family members: If you are planning to travel outside of Canada with your family, each family member must have a valid passport.
Passports with an "X" gender identifier: The Government of Canada issues passports with an "X" gender identifier, but other countries cannot guarantee entry or passage.
Temporary or emergency travel documents: Different entry rules may apply when traveling with a temporary passport or emergency travel document.
